Fees and Cost Over Time
QQQ charges 0.18% per year while WILD charges 1.29%. On a $10,000 position that is $18 vs $129 annually, a gap of $111 per year that compounds over a long holding period. On income, QQQ currently yields 0.44% against 0.00% for WILD.
